BREAKING: Tinubu agrees to pay N70,000 as new minimum wage

President Bola Ahmed Tinubu has agreed to implement a new minimum wage of N70,000.

This was announced by the Minister of Information and National Orientation, Mohammed Idris, following a meeting between government officials and organised labour held Thursday, 18th July 2024.

The meeting, attended by prominent Labour leaders, including Nigerian Labour Congress (NLC) President Joe Ajaero and Trade Union Congress (TUC) President Festus Osifo, commenced at 2:15 PM with the arrival of the labour delegation in a white 32-seater Coaster bus, which headed straight to the President’s first-floor office for discussions.
